Answer: Choice #2 (He peered at me from the other side of the room.)
Explanation:
The four verbs are looked, peered, sat, and was for sentences 1-4 respectively.
Out of those four verbs, sat and was are extremely basic, common, and uninteresting verbs.
Peered is a more powerful synonym to looked, thus making it the vivid verb.
